The testing below is specifically for checking the usability of the login screens and administrative pages for EZProxy. It is NOT meant to be an exhaustive testing of links. 
Our configuration for EZProxy is set up so that if users are ON CAMPUS, they should not be prompted to login to third party databases.

Considerations
  • First, if we are specifically testing the login experience, remember you HAVE to be off campus or using a hotspot/cell phone to mimic off campus. Otherwise you'll go directly to the resource links. 
  • You'll probably have to clear your cache over and over again while testing because once you login once successfully, it will remember you across platforms


Tasks
  • Login with USDOne credentials
  • Login with Visiting Patron credentials (contact Bee if you don't have any sample credentials to use)
  • Enter incorrect credentials for USDOne, and then try again
  • Enter incorrect credentials for Visiting Patron, and then try again
  • Change your Sierra Visiting Patron account to have an outdated expiration date and make sure you get the account expired message.
  • Try proxying a fake link (ie, https://sandiego.idm.oclc.org/login?url=http://www.fruitloops.com) to make sure it gives you the Oops screen
  • Be creative! Do weird things and see what weird experiences you can have. 


Devices, Browsers, Systems
Test on several different devices (cell, tablet, desktop) and variety of browsers to make sure experience is more or less the same.
